Subject: Splitwise-2 cut-over complete

Team,

The migration of the experiment assignment service from the old Bucketeer cluster to Splitwise-2 finished tonight without incident. Assignment latency is back under target and the hash ring rebalanced cleanly. Old Bucketeer nodes stay warm for one week as a fallback. If you get paged, verify the service came up with the following configuration.

deployment values, kajep-kageg:
[praix]
host = praix.paliqcorp.corp
user = praix_svc
database = praix_prod

Subject: Quickstore 4.2 — bloom filter now fronts the KV layer

Plugin authors: starting with this release, Quickstore places a bloom filter ahead of the key-value store. Negative lookups return faster; false positives fall through safely. No API changes are required on your side. Verify your plugin against the staging build referenced below.

session token of fahif-tadup = htk3_9c7

# Vantorel Service Environments

Welcome aboard. Vantorel runs three environments: dev, staging, and production. The tax-rate lookup cache behaves differently in each — dev uses an in-memory store that resets on restart, while staging and production share a replicated cache with a six-hour refresh cycle. Please never point a dev build at the production cache, as stale rate entries can poison downstream invoice calculations. The production cache layer is configured as follows.

service settings:
PRAWYN_PIN=9848
PRAWYN_METRICS_HOST=metrics.prawyn.lumicworks.corp
PRAWYN_LOG_LEVEL=warn
PRAWYN_TENANT=pelius

Pinning policy for the Harkwell release train: all third-party dependencies are pinned to exact versions with checksums recorded in the lockfile. No ranges, no floating tags. Upgrades land through a dedicated review lane with diff scans by the Ostermere tooling team. Builds that resolve anything outside the lockfile fail hard. Release artifacts are then signed so downstream mirrors can verify provenance. Verify signatures against the key below.

deploy key for kajof-fajop: bky6_gDHw9Q